OpenAI Ousts Altman as CEO; Board Says It Lost Confidence in Him

Nov. 18, 2023, 1:26 AM UTC

Sam Altman, one of the most prominent figures in the world of artificial intelligence, is being forced out of OpenAI — the company behind the wildly popular ChatGPT chatbot he helped to create — after the board said it had lost confidence in him as a leader.

Mira Murati, an Albanian-born Dartmouth-educated engineer who helped develop some of OpenAI’s best-known products as its chief technology officer, will serve as OpenAI’s interim chief executive officer.
